Solution for 2[2w-6]=6[w-6]+14 equation:


Simplifying
2[2w + -6] = 6[w + -6] + 14

Reorder the terms:
2[-6 + 2w] = 6[w + -6] + 14
[-6 * 2 + 2w * 2] = 6[w + -6] + 14
[-12 + 4w] = 6[w + -6] + 14

Reorder the terms:
-12 + 4w = 6[-6 + w] + 14
-12 + 4w = [-6 * 6 + w * 6] + 14
-12 + 4w = [-36 + 6w] + 14

Reorder the terms:
-12 + 4w = -36 + 14 + 6w

Combine like terms: -36 + 14 = -22
-12 + 4w = -22 + 6w

Solving
-12 + 4w = -22 + 6w

Solving for variable 'w'.

Move all terms containing w to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-6w' to each side of the equation.
-12 + 4w + -6w = -22 + 6w + -6w

Combine like terms: 4w + -6w = -2w
-12 + -2w = -22 + 6w + -6w

Combine like terms: 6w + -6w = 0
-12 + -2w = -22 + 0
-12 + -2w = -22

Add '12' to each side of the equation.
-12 + 12 + -2w = -22 + 12

Combine like terms: -12 + 12 = 0
0 + -2w = -22 + 12
-2w = -22 + 12

Combine like terms: -22 + 12 = -10
-2w = -10

Divide each side by '-2'.
w = 5

Simplifying
w = 5
